At the 100k mark I have taken the throttle body off and cleaned the channels, the IACV (00-05), the map sensor, the map sensor channel, and cleaned the surfaces for the gasket. Usually after doing that I adjust the throttle on all S2000s.

I did also clean my PCV Valve and it still wasn't right so I replaced it. The slight amount of oil wasn't major. I do have the Rain H8r baffle mod too
